The station offers a comprehensive range of amenities to ensure a comfortable experience for every traveler. The ticket office is open from 5:30 AM to 12:20 AM on weekdays and 7:36 AM to 12:20 AM on Sundays. Ticket machines are conveniently located throughout the station, and the presence of smartcard facilities makes purchasing and collecting tickets efficient. Accessibility is a priority with step-free access available, supported by lifts for easy platform navigation.
Helpline services provide much-needed assistance, available up to two hours before your journey, ensuring all travelers can move with confidence. The station also features essential services like CCTV for safety, refreshment facilities, and a convenience store for light shopping. Though luggage storage isn't available, the station provides seating areas for relaxation while you wait for your train.

Nunthorpe Station keeps things simple. While there's no ticket office, travelers can access ticket machines to collect their online purchases. Sadly, there are no smartcard validators, but you'll find an induction loop available, along with a help point for additional support. The absence of toilets and waiting rooms signifies the station's minimalist setup, yet it remains functional for daily commuters.
For those with mobility concerns, the station provides partial step-free access. Ramps and level paths allow for smooth transitions to and from the platforms, ensuring wheelchair users aren't left stranded. Car parking is open round the clock, with six spaces available at no charge, although none are specifically designated for accessible parking.
A journey from Nunthorpe Station extends beyond just rail tracks. The local bus service can be reached conveniently, connecting to other locales through Busline 0871 200 2233. For road travelers, taxis can be conveniently booked through a dedicated service on Northern Railway's website. Should you find yourself needing to replace rail services, distinct stops on Guisborough Road serve this purpose.
